A subtle glow and refined geometry come together in this set of two “Fatua” table lamps by Guido Rosati for Fontana Arte. Designed in the 1970s, these lamps quietly express the Italian approach to sculptural lighting—pared down but never plain.
Design
Each piece consists of a single blown glass cylinder with a seamless two-tone effect: satin-finished on the lower half and clear above. The transition isn’t defined by a hard edge but by a gradual shift in opacity that softens the light as it escapes. This method gives the lamps a natural layering, almost like fog lifting from a surface. Inside, a simple socket structure holds the bulb in place without distraction. With the light turned on, the diffused section casts a warm, ambient tone, while the transparent section provides subtle volume and presence. Guido Rosati’s intent is evident in the precision and restraint.
Originally produced by Fontana Arte, the model is well documented and appreciated for its quiet versatility.
